FS9 Scenery - Livermore Municipal Airport (IATA: LVK, ICAO: KLVK) is in Livermore, California, USA, east of San Francisco Bay. The airport is three miles northwest of the downtown area. Near the 650-acre airport are the Water Reclamation Plant and the Las Positas Golf Course. There are two parallel asphalt runways. The main lighted runway is 5,250 ft long and the second runway, unlighted, built in 1985, is 2,700 ft long is used mainly for training. Besides the 2,400 sq ft Terminal building, built in 1969, there are nearly 400 aircraft storage hangar units as well as a corporate-style hangar building containing 20,000 sq ft of space along with an aircraft storage shelter. This is a recreation of Treasure Island in San Fransisco. This
scenery inclueds The Pan Am sea plane base at the south end of
the Island and the Navy airfield at the north end. At the Pan Am
end there was the two big hangars, two smaller hangar side by side
and the Pan American terminal. At the Navy end there was two runways
for a short time, but about the mid 30's the Navy removed one
of the runways and most of the Navy airtrafic consiced of the
airships.
In this scenery addon I included boath runway on at the Navy end
of the airfield and Pan Am's installation at the south end.

This scenery and its traffic represents Zaragoza AB (LEZG) in the Cold War era of the late 50s to early 60s. Zaragoza was one of three major Cold War US air bases in Spain, the others being Torrejon (also available here and at other sites) and Moron. Zaragoza served as a Reflex base for Strategic Air Command, hosting various B-47 units doing rotational duty at the base along with permanently assigned fighters for air defense purposes. It was shared with the Spanish Air Force which flew the F-86F. All of this is represented in this retro version of Zaragoza AFB including Traffic for 1958 and 1962.

These islands were mysteriously absent from the FS2004 default scenery, probably owing to their small size. When I went to look for them I found a small mountain of water instead of the islands.
Most people don't seem to be aware of the Farallon Islands. Located off the coast of California, near San Francisco, they are home to thousands of birds, seals, and some of the largest Great White sharks known to man. All of this is within a very short distance of the city.
Today, it is a wildlife refuge and is off limits to visitation by the general public. Those of you interested in more info might check out "The Devil's Teeth" by Susan Casey.
